Question 1: What is the primary mechanism by which resistance training contributes to long-term fat loss, beyond the calories burned during the session?
- It increases flexibility and reduces injury risk
- It builds muscle mass, which raises resting metabolic rate (Correct answer)
- It suppresses appetite for 24 hours
- It directly converts fat tissue into muscle
Correct answer: It builds muscle mass, which raises resting metabolic rate
Each pound of muscle burns approximately 6β10 additional calories per day at rest, compounding fat loss over time.
Question 2: A competitive bodybuilder 12 weeks out from a show is experiencing a weight-loss plateau. What advanced strategy should they consider first?
- Immediately double cardio volume
- Take a one-week diet break at maintenance calories to reset leptin (Correct answer)
- Switch entirely to a liquid diet
- Eliminate all dietary fat
Correct answer: Take a one-week diet break at maintenance calories to reset leptin
A diet break at maintenance calories can restore leptin and thyroid hormone levels, restoring the body's fat-burning responsiveness.

Question 4: What is 'carb cycling' and why is it used in advanced fat-loss protocols?
- Eating only complex carbs in a circular rotation
- Alternating high and low carbohydrate days to optimize fat burning while fueling intense training (Correct answer)
- Consuming carbs exclusively post-workout every day
- Eliminating carbs on non-training days permanently
Correct answer: Alternating high and low carbohydrate days to optimize fat burning while fueling intense training
Carb cycling maintains glycogen for performance on training days while promoting fat oxidation on lower-carb days.

Question 6: In advanced body recomposition, what does a 'mini-cut' refer to?
- Reducing portion sizes by 5% permanently
- A short, aggressive caloric deficit (2β6 weeks) designed to strip fat while minimizing muscle loss (Correct answer)
- Cutting out a single food group for one week
- Eating only one meal per day for a month
Correct answer: A short, aggressive caloric deficit (2β6 weeks) designed to strip fat while minimizing muscle loss
Mini-cuts use a brief, steep deficit to lose fat quickly before returning to maintenance or a surplus, limiting the duration of metabolic adaptation.
Question 7: When using time-restricted eating (TRE) for fat loss, which eating window has the most research support?
- 2-hour window (22:2)
- 8-hour window (16:8) (Correct answer)
- 14-hour window (10:14)
- 1-hour window (23:1)
Correct answer: 8-hour window (16:8)
The 16:8 protocol (16-hour fast, 8-hour eating window) has the most clinical evidence supporting fat loss with preserved lean mass.
